Liverpool transfer bargain
Chronicle Live report Liverpool are hoping to sign Sunderland’s 15-year-old midfielder Luca Stephenson – but for considerably less than the £500,000 fee reported.
Sources on Merseyside have confirmed that the Reds are optimistic of striking a deal, but for around a third of the price quoted in a report in the Sun on Sunday.
Stephenson has drawn comparisons with fellow Wearsider Jordan Henderson, who made the move as a first-teamer for £16m in 2011.
